Fox debuted the first footage from the Steven Spielberg and Peter Chernin family adventure-drama series "Terra Nova" during the Super Bowl and you can now watch the video using the player below!
"Terra Nova" will preview during a special two-night event Monday, May 23 (9:00-10:00 PM ET/PT) and Tuesday, May 24 (9:00-10:00 PM ET/PT) on Fox. The show will then premiere in the fall.
